| package com.google.common.util.concurrent; |
| |
| import static com.google.common.truth.Truth.assertThat; |
| |
| import java.util.concurrent.Callable; |
| import java.util.concurrent.ExecutionException; |
| import java.util.concurrent.TimeUnit; |
| import junit.framework.TestCase; |
| |
| /** |
| * Unit test for {@link FakeTimeLimiter}. |
| * |
| * @author Jens Nyman |
| */ |
| public class FakeTimeLimiterTest extends TestCase { |
| |
| private static final int DELAY_MS = 50; |
| private static final String RETURN_VALUE = "abc"; |
| |
| private TimeLimiter timeLimiter; |
| |
| @Override |
| protected void setUp() throws Exception { |
| super.setUp(); |
| timeLimiter = new FakeTimeLimiter(); |
| } |
| |
| public void testCallWithTimeout_propagatesReturnValue() throws Exception { |
| String result = |
| timeLimiter.callWithTimeout( |
| Callables.returning(RETURN_VALUE), DELAY_MS, TimeUnit.MILLISECONDS); |
| |
| assertThat(result).isEqualTo(RETURN_VALUE); |
| } |
| |
| public void testCallWithTimeout_wrapsCheckedException() throws Exception { |
| Exception exception = new SampleCheckedException(); |
| try { |
| timeLimiter.callWithTimeout(callableThrowing(exception), DELAY_MS, TimeUnit.MILLISECONDS); |
| fail("Expected ExecutionException"); |
| } catch (ExecutionException e) { |
| assertThat(e.getCause()).isEqualTo(exception); |
| } |
| } |
| |
| public void testCallWithTimeout_wrapsUncheckedException() throws Exception { |
| Exception exception = new RuntimeException("test"); |
| try { |
| timeLimiter.callWithTimeout(callableThrowing(exception), DELAY_MS, TimeUnit.MILLISECONDS); |
| fail("Expected UncheckedExecutionException"); |
| } catch (UncheckedExecutionException e) { |
| assertThat(e.getCause()).isEqualTo(exception); |
| } |
| } |
| |
| public void testCallUninterruptiblyWithTimeout_propagatesReturnValue() throws Exception { |
| String result = |
| timeLimiter.callUninterruptiblyWithTimeout( |
| Callables.returning(RETURN_VALUE), DELAY_MS, TimeUnit.MILLISECONDS); |
| |
| assertThat(result).isEqualTo(RETURN_VALUE); |
| } |
| |
| public void testRunWithTimeout_returnsWithoutException() throws Exception { |
| timeLimiter.runWithTimeout(Runnables.doNothing(), DELAY_MS, TimeUnit.MILLISECONDS); |
| } |
| |
| public void testRunWithTimeout_wrapsUncheckedException() throws Exception { |
| RuntimeException exception = new RuntimeException("test"); |
| try { |
| timeLimiter.runWithTimeout(runnableThrowing(exception), DELAY_MS, TimeUnit.MILLISECONDS); |
| fail("Expected UncheckedExecutionException"); |
| } catch (UncheckedExecutionException e) { |
| assertThat(e.getCause()).isEqualTo(exception); |
| } |
| } |
| |
| public void testRunUninterruptiblyWithTimeout_wrapsUncheckedException() throws Exception { |
| RuntimeException exception = new RuntimeException("test"); |
| try { |
| timeLimiter.runUninterruptiblyWithTimeout( |
| runnableThrowing(exception), DELAY_MS, TimeUnit.MILLISECONDS); |
| fail("Expected UncheckedExecutionException"); |
| } catch (UncheckedExecutionException e) { |
| assertThat(e.getCause()).isEqualTo(exception); |
| } |
| } |
| |
| public static <T> Callable<T> callableThrowing(final Exception exception) { |
| return new Callable<T>() { |
| @Override |
| public T call() throws Exception { |
| throw exception; |
| } |
| }; |
| } |
| |
| private static Runnable runnableThrowing(final RuntimeException e) { |
| return new Runnable() { |
| @Override |
| public void run() { |
| throw e; |
| } |
| }; |
| } |
| |
| @SuppressWarnings("serial") |
| private static class SampleCheckedException extends Exception {} |
| } |
